摘    要:在城市遥感中,道路自动(半自动)提取一直是研究的霞点.本文在现有道路自动(半自动)提取技术的基础上,结合高分辨率遥感影像中行道树的分布特点,从地学知识出发,利用归一化筹值植被指数、阀值分割、数学形态学算子及地理信息系统的分析功能等实现基于行道树的道路自动(半自动)提取和道路面积快速、自动计算.结论表明基于行道树的道路提取和面积计算方法具有一定的实用性.

Abstract:The road automatic (semi-automatic) extraction is a focal studied point of the city remote sensing. Based on the current road automatic (semi-automatic) extraction technique and combining the distinct street trees in the high-resolution remotely sensed image, this paper utilizes some methods in geonomy to implement the road automatic (semi-automatic) extraction and the rapid, automatic algorithms of the road size based on the street trees, including NDVI, thresholding segmentation, the relevant operators of...
